The industry is changing fast — and if you’re not paying attention, you’re falling behind. We’ve rounded up 5 key updates from the past few months that every mobile marketer should have on their radar.
📱 Telegram Launches Global Search Ads
What happened: Telegram has introduced keyword-based sponsored results in its global search. Ads now appear when users search for content — similar to Apple Search Ads or Google Play search.
Why it matters: With over 900M monthly active users and a strong stance on privacy, Telegram could become a valuable new performance marketing channel outside the Meta-Google stronghold.
Think about it: Early adopters may benefit from low CPMs and first-mover advantage. Source
📈 ChatGPT Becomes One of the Most Installed Apps in March
What happened: According to AppFigures, ChatGPT was one of the most downloaded apps globally in March 2025 — outperforming TikTok, Instagram, and several major games.
Why it matters: AI is no longer niche — it’s mainstream. Users are now comfortable interacting with AI apps daily, and that changes how they engage with content and products.
Think about it: User behavior is shifting toward conversational interfaces. Apps that integrate AI-native onboarding or support may see better retention and engagement.
🔄 Apple Search Ads Finally Joins the SKAN Party
What happened: Apple Search Ads is now fully integrated with SKAdNetwork (also known as AdAttributionKit). This means better attribution and conversion tracking for iOS campaigns — with user privacy still intact.
Why it matters: For marketers running campaigns on iOS, this is a big step forward. Accurate data is finally back — no need to rely on fingerprinting or guesswork.
Think about it: If you’re not optimizing for SKAN 4.0+ today, you’re likely misreading performance and missing out on smarter budget allocation.
📺 T-Mobile Acquires Vistar Media for $600M
What happened: T-Mobile has acquired Vistar Media, a major digital out-of-home (DOOH) advertising platform, for $600 million.
Why it matters: Telecom companies are becoming serious players in advertising. With access to both user data and ad inventory, telcos are positioned to dominate across multiple channels.
Think about it: Telcos entering adtech means stronger identity graphs and omnichannel reach — DOOH might soon be as trackable as mobile.
🛍️ Alternative App Stores Are Rising Fast
What happened: OEMs like Samsung, Huawei, and Xiaomi are rapidly growing their own app stores. The shift is backed by regulations like the EU’s Digital Markets Act, which challenges the App Store and Google Play dominance.
Why it matters: Marketers can no longer focus on just two ecosystems. Alternative stores may offer new growth, lower competition, and better terms.
Think about it: Diversifying your distribution early could reduce CPI, increase discoverability, and future-proof your UA in regulated markets.
